I recently requested a CLI from Cabella's (8.15.16) from current $10k to $15k, they pulled Equifax which is currently at 767. The request was granted within 2 days and with no comments of than a letter of congrats. Cabela's seems universally to require a HP for CLI's at any point, regardless of credit score. This did not used to be the case several years ago, but within the last year, they almost exclusively seem to require HP to advance at all with the card limit. Many of us with FICO's in the 730-740 range (myself included) have closed our Cabela's cards because the limit was just stuck. It's not a card that I am willing to take a HP on - I will save those for other cards, if needed.
